Contact

Contact

Get in Touch

    Connect with us here

    Our forefathers may have navigated our oceans using stars and planets, but there is a far more efficient way of getting to us.

    Address

    71-75 Shelton Street, London, Greater London, WC2H 9JQ, UNITED KINGDOM

    Sales Enquiries

    0800 781 8869

    Customer Support

    contact@vessconn.com